#031dd2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#031dd2 is composed of 1.2% red, 11.4%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.6% cyan, 86.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 232.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.2% and a lightness of 41.8%. #031dd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#063aff with #0000a5.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#031dd2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#031dd2 has RGB values of R:3, G:29,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 204242.

Shades and Tints of #031dd2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000211 is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.
